The magnitude of a vector, v, is its absolute length, measured between the tail and head of the vector. Another name for the magnitude of v is the Euclidean norm of v, in honor of Euclid, one of the first mathematicians to do serious work concerning the geometry of length, distance, and angles.4. Solve for the magnitude. Using the equation above, you can plug in the numbers of the ordered pair of the vector to solve for the magnitude. The magnitude of a number (also called its absolute value) is its distance from zero, so. • the magnitude of 6 is 6. • the magnitude of −6 is also 6. The magnitude of a vector is its length (ignoring direction). Play with a vector below:

All quantities that can be expressed as a product of a specific power of 10 are said to be ... survey development Magnitude is the most common measure of an earthquake's size. It is a measure of the size of the earthquake source and is the same number no matter where you are or what the shaking feels like. The Richter scale is an outdated method for measuring magnitude that is no longer used by the USGS for large, teleseismic earthquakes.The Richter scale (/ ˈ r ɪ k t ər /), also called the Richter magnitude scale, Richter's magnitude scale, and the Gutenberg-Richter scale, is a measure of the strength of earthquakes, developed by Charles Francis Richter and presented in his landmark 1935 paper, where he called it the "magnitude scale".
